Stranded in the Snow

On the 29 December 1992, Jennifer and Jim Stolpa and their baby son Clayton set off on a 1000-mile trip from their home in California to a family funeral in Idaho. The couple were determined to be there and they left despite bad weather warnings. They were young and confidant and were not going to be beaten by a bit of snow. As they headed north-east out of the San Francisco bay area, their main route on the interstate highway was cut off by blizzards. Undeterred, Jim and Jennifer planned another route using minor roads. They had snow chains fitted to their truck and so headed off with no qualms. However, they didn't have a mobile phone and couldn't find a working pay phone to call relatives and let them know what they were doing. |
